Description

The PCT-VC-F14-AN1 amplifier provides complete amplification and home networking support in one package. First, the F14A is designed to amplify your incoming cable (or antenna) signal and distribute it to up to FOUR separate locations. It takes the incoming signal, boosts it about 7x, and then outputs that same signal to all of the output ports (except the MODEM/Bypass port). This provides you with a strong coaxial signal to all of your locations in your home. The PCT VC-F14A supports all cable and OTA TV signals, and provides a MODEM port which is active even during system or power failure - to provide a signal to your cable modem or other communications device. In addition, the F14A supports MoCA (Media over Coaxial Alliance) signals, which operate outside the normal TV range (1125 to 1525 MHz). A MoCA network uses coaxial cables—like the cords that screw into the back of your TV—to connect your modem to the internet. Since most homes only have one or two Ethernet ports, utilizing the coaxial cables (traditionally used to connect your television to set-top boxes and cable TV in each room) gives you more options to connect to wired internet throughout the house. The PCT VC-F14A supports the transmission of MoCA signals over your existing coax cable, while also blocking those signals from leaving your home - through the use of a MoCA blocking filter on the INPUT of the amplifier. PCT amplifiers have precision machined F ports (conforms to SCTE standards) with beryllium copper seizure mechanisms to provide optimal distribution and amplification of your RF signals.
